Main Flight Stops in Buenos Aires

Ministro Pistarini International Airport (EZE)

Located about 35 kilometers (22 miles) southwest of Buenos Aires city center, EZE is the largest airport serving the Argentine capital and is situated near the town of Ezeiza.

Main Flight Stops in Belo Horizonte

Tancredo Neves International Airport (CNF)

Located approximately 40 kilometers (25 miles) northeast of Belo Horizonte, CNF is situated in Confins, offering convenient access to the state of Minas Gerais.
